2026 Central Florida Showdown Player Spotlights
2031 Colton Beauregard
Kangaroo Court Roos American Fly
Colton has a highly projectable frame and proved he can impact the game in multiple facets. At the plate, he features a balanced setup with good rhythm and timing, paired with quick hands and strong barrel accuracy that allowed him to consistently make loud contact. He was an offensive force all weekend, collecting 5 hits and driving in 7 runs. On the mound, he was just as effective, showing poise and control while working 7 innings, allowing only 2 earned runs and striking out 3. His ability to compete and contribute on both sides of the ball made a major difference. Colton’s all-around performance helped lead his team to a Gold Bracket Championship and earned himself MVP honors.

2030 Eiden O’Farrill
Diamond Elite 14u Scout National
Eiden has a lean, athletic frame and showcased his ability to impact the game on both sides all weekend. At the plate, he features a quick, twitchy swing with strong bat-to-ball skills and a solid all-fields approach, allowing him to consistently produce. He put together an impressive offensive performance, tallying 8 hits, scoring 8 runs, and driving in 7 RBIs while posting a 0.533 batting average. On the mound, Eiden works from a smooth high three-quarters delivery and shows the ability to command both sides of the plate. He mixes a fastball siting 80-82 mph with a slider at 69-71 mph, keeping hitters off balance. Over the weekend, he tossed 5.2 innings and struck out 7. Eiden’s two-way impact played a major role in leading his team to a championship finish, earning him well-deserved MVP honors.

2029 Jaedyn Hammond
GSB Prospects 16u
Jaedyn has a lean, athletic frame and showcased his ability to control the game on the mound throughout the weekend. He works wit ha free and easy low three-quarters delivery, with plenty of projection remaining as he continues to add velocity. He demonstrated strong command of both sides of the plate, featuring a fastball sitting 79-82 mph with arm-side run and a curveball at 64-66 mph with late vertical break that consistently kept hitters off balance. Over the weekend, Jaedyn tossed 6.1 scoreless innings while striking out 6, showing poise and the ability to work efficiently through lineups. Jaedyn’s performance on the mound played a key role in helping lead his team on a strong playoff run.
